Council of Ministers Expresses Support for US Efforts towards Peace in Ukraine

Bulgaria welcomed the consistent efforts of the US and President Donald Trump aimed at achieving a ceasefire and establishing a just and lasting peace in Ukraine, the Council of Ministers said on Facebook on Saturday.

"The final terms of a future peace agreement would directly affect the security of Bulgaria, the European Union and all of Europe. In this regard, it is necessary to work in close coordination on the 28-point document presented by the United States in the pursuit of sustainable peace," the post reads.

"We remain committed to working with our EU and US partners to ensure that the future peace agreement is properly observed. We will monitor to ensure that Ukraine receives reliable guarantees for its security. The Republic of Bulgaria maintains its position that in the 21st century internationally recognized borders should not be altered by force," the Cabinet added.

The Government stressed that Bulgaria has been consistent in its support for Ukraine from the outbreak of hostilities to the present day. "The Ukrainian people alone can determine their own future and direction of development, as well as take decisions regarding the nature of any proposed peace agreement and its implications for the future of Ukrainian citizens," the statement reads.
